Brooklyn’s OSR Tapes has been a not-for-profit label since 2007, and according to their website, this will be the final year of releases for the label. Most recently released on vinyl from OSR are CE Schneider Topical’s Antifree and Maher Shalal Hash Baz’s Hello NewYork.

CE Schneider Topical dropped a video for “female in images,” and you can stream the album in full on the OSR Bandcamp page. Whoa, what’s Casey Jones doing here? And how are they using time travel?
